About P.V. Pistecky

P.V. Pistecky is a scholar working on Surgery, Pulmonary and Respiratory Medicine and Orthopedics and Sports Medicine, having authored 13 papers that have together received 324 indexed citations. Recurring topics across this work include Cardiac and Coronary Surgery Techniques (5 papers), Coronary Interventions and Diagnostics (4 papers) and Shoulder Injury and Treatment (3 papers). The work is most often cited by research in Surgery (250 citations), Biomaterials (64 citations) and Biomedical Engineering (156 citations). P.V. Pistecky has collaborated with scholars based in Netherlands. Frequent co-authors include Cornelius Borst, Carolien J. van Andel, Just L. Herder, Eveline A.M. Heijnsdijk, Hendrik G. Visser, Gabriëlle J. M. Tuijthof, C. N. van Dijk, Peter E. Scholten, C. Niek van Dijk and Paul F. Gründeman. Their work appears in journals such as Journal of Thoracic and Cardiovascular Surgery, The Annals of Thoracic Surgery and Surgical Endoscopy.
